I love the work that has been put into these new textures!  I'm having a wee problem, though: has anyone else seen any UI corruption while using this in ME1?  I've played through ME1/2/3 multiple times without a problem, so I know it has something to do with the addtion of TEXMOD in general or these textures in particular.

I'm using: Win7x64, NVIDIA drivers, LAA (got an "Out of Virtual Memory" error in ME1 if I didn't), and CDAMJC's latest FULL texture package (haven't tried the smaller "32bit" version yet).

I've tried completely shutting down the game (including TEXMOD) and restarting, but the problem always returns.

Also, and this may be in the wrong thread, but I cant Get TexMod to work. Here is what I do.

1. I have MassEffect.exe renamed to MassEffectoriginal.exe.
2. I have TexMod renamed to MassEffect.exe.
3. In STEAM, I click on the PLAY button for Mass Effect, a box ops up saying "This game is currently unavailable. Please try again at another time."
4. I launch TexMod (renamed MassEffect.exe) directly, select the MassEffectoriginal.exe (the real MassEffect.exe), then I select the Package FULLPACK042012 (I have all three of these files in Binaries directory), then I click Run, and again, the STEAM - ERROR comes up, "This game is currently unavailable. Please try again at another time."
5. Clicking on MassEffectoriginal (the real MassEffect.exe) directly in the Binaries directory also brings up the STEAM - ERROR.
6. Going back to the Mass Effect directory and using the MassEffectLauncher shows the Play button to be greyed out, cannot launch game from Launcher.7. Renamed MassEffectoriginal.exe back to MassEffect.exe, and the game was able to launch, minus the mod pack.

There, I have given an exact, step by step of what I have done, have I missed anything? Any idea why it won't work?
